The basic theory and application of second generation wavelet transform, second generation wavelet de-noising in machinery fault diagnosis technology and second generation wavelet signal process system based on matlab are studied in the thesis. Firstly, the purpose and significance of the task are set forth. Secondly, the signal processing method including FFT, wavelet analysis, wavelet packet analysis theory are introduced; Thirdly, the theory and implementation method of second generation wavelet transform is introduced, the solving process and classification of the predictor and updater and the coefficients with different order are computed. the construction method of second generation biorthogonal wavelet based on lifting scheme are studied, the scale and wavelet function figures with two, four, six and eight order are ploted. At last, apply the second generation wavelet transform to extracting fault features of the mine ventilator, the rubbing fault between rotor and stator of the ventilator is diagnosed successfully. The results show that second generation wavelet transform has great advantages including simple algorithm, fast operation, low memory, simple wavelet construction method and so on.The theory of second generation wavelet de-noising, the selecting scheme of shrinkage and shrinkage function are studied, and the simulation signal is used to test the scheme, then apply it to the de-noising of the vibration signal of a mine ventilator and its fault diagnosis, the unsymmetry fault is diagnosed. The results show that this scheme can improve the SNR, decrease the noise from the original signal and improve the accuracy of the fault diagnosis effectively.The second generation wavelet signal process system based on matlab is studied, the second generation wavelet decomposition, recomposition, de-noising, structure scale-function constitution, wavelet function constitution, spectrum analysis are realized.
